  • The CropSAR-2D Near Real Time collection is the Sentinel-2 data cloud-free with a regularity of five-day intervals.The collection currently offers only FAPAR products.FAPAR corresponds to the fraction of photosynthetically active radiation absorbed by the canopy. The FAPAR value results directly from the radiative transfer model in the canopy which is computed instantaneously. It depends on canopy structure, vegetation element optical properties and illumination conditions. FAPAR is very useful as input to a number of primary productivity models which run at the daily time step. Consequently, the product definition should correspond to the daily integrated FAPAR value that can be approached by computation of the clear sky daily integrated FAPAR values as well as the FAPAR value computed for diffuse conditions. The CropSAR-2D FAPAR product was produced using the CropSAR_px service provided by VITO that uses Sentinel-1 GRD and Sentinel-2 L2A products offered by the Copernicus Data Space Ecosystem.
